1. Understanding the Case Study Task | 理解案例分析任务
The CCEA case study typically presents a short text in Spanish – often a newspaper article, blog post, or extract from a report – followed by comprehension questions and a discursive or evaluative task. Students must show they can extract factual information, infer meaning, recognise opinions, and transfer relevant points into a structured response.
CCEA 的案例分析通常给出一段西班牙语短文——时常是报纸文章、博客或报告节选——然后设置理解性问题和一个讨论性或评价性的任务。学生必须展现出能提取事实信息、推断含义、识别观点,并将相关要点组织成结构化的回答。
The assessment objectives focus on reading for gist and detail, selecting and summarising evidence, and presenting arguments or reflections. Part of the response may be in Spanish and part in English, so switching accurately between languages is essential.
评估目标集中在抓主旨和细节阅读、筛选和总结证据、提出论点或反思。部分回答可能需要用西班牙语、部分用英语,因此准确地在两种语言之间切换至关重要。

2. Effective Reading Strategies | 高效阅读策略
Approaching a Spanish text under exam conditions requires more than a linear translation. Start with a quick skim to grasp the overall theme and tone. Look at the title, any subheadings, and the opening sentences of each paragraph. This initial scan builds a mental framework before you examine details.
在考试条件下阅读西班牙语文本需要的不只是线性翻译。先从快速略读开始,把握整体主题和语气。关注标题、副标题和每个段落的首句。这种初步浏览能在你深入细节之前在脑中搭建起框架。
After the skim, read the questions carefully. This will direct your second, more focused read. Underline or highlight key phrases that match the question prompts, such as causes, consequences, advantages, and specific data. Do not get stuck on unknown words; try to deduce their meaning from context.
略读之后,仔细阅读问题。这会指导你的第二次、更有针对性的阅读。划出或高亮与问题提示词匹配的关键短语,如原因、后果、优势、具体数据。不要在生词上卡住;试着根据上下文推测其含义。
| Strategy | Description | When to use |
| Skimming | Rapid reading for gist and structure | First encounter with the text |
| Scanning | Searching for specific words or data | After reading questions |
| Intensive reading | Close analysis of meaning and tone | Answering inferential questions |

3. Key Vocabulary for Social Issues | 社会议题关键词汇
Case studies frequently deal with contemporary themes such as the environment, education, immigration, unemployment, and digital culture. Building a robust topic-specific vocabulary bank allows you to understand texts more quickly and express ideas with precision. Below are essential lexical sets organised by theme.
案例分析经常涉及环境、教育、移民、失业和数字文化等当代主题。建立一个扎实的话题词汇库能让你更快理解文本,并用精准的语言表达观点。以下是按主题整理的核心词汇集。
-
Environment (el medio ambiente): el cambio climático, la contaminación, las energías renovables, la deforestación, la sostenibilidad, los residuos, el reciclaje.
环境:气候变化、污染、可再生能源、森林砍伐、可持续性、废弃物、回收利用。
-
Education (la educación): el fracaso escolar, la formación profesional, las becas, la igualdad de oportunidades, la tasa de abandono, el acoso escolar, la educación a distancia.
教育:学业失败、职业培训、奖学金、机会平等、辍学率、校园霸凌、远程教育。
-
Society (la sociedad): la desigualdad social, la integración, la inmigración, el desempleo juvenil, la brecha salarial, la tercera edad, la conciliación familiar.
社会:社会不平等、融入、移民、青年失业、工资差距、老年人、家庭平衡。
-
Technology (la tecnología): las redes sociales, la adicción al móvil, la privacidad, la inteligencia artificial, la ciberseguridad, la brecha digital.
科技:社交网络、手机成瘾、隐私、人工智能、网络安全、数字鸿沟。
Active recall of these terms can be enhanced by creating flashcards or mind maps. Trying to use them in your own sample sentences will also embed them more deeply.

4. Analysing Authentic Texts | 分析真实语料
Authentic texts often contain idiomatic expressions, transitional phrases, and cultural references that add layers of meaning. Recognising discourse markers like ‘sin embargo’, ‘por lo tanto’, ‘además’, and ‘a pesar de que’ helps you follow the logical flow and identify contrasts or concessions.
真实语料通常包含惯用表达、过渡短语和文化参照,为意义增添了层次。识别像 “sin embargo”、”por lo tanto”、”además”、”a pesar de que” 这样的话语标记,有助于你跟上逻辑脉络,辨别对比或让步。
Pay attention to the author’s use of impersonal constructions (‘se dice que…’, ‘es necesario que…’) which indicate general opinion or recommendation. Subjunctive triggers often signal doubt, desire, or subjectivity – key clues for evaluative questions.
注意作者使用的无人称结构(”se dice que…”、”es necesario que…”),它们表示普遍观点或建议。虚拟式触发词通常暗示怀疑、愿望或主观性——这是评价性问题的关键线索。
For example, a sentence like ‘Es fundamental que los gobiernos inviertan más en energías limpias’ reveals a strong opinion and a call to action. You would be expected to identify this as a recommendation rather than a fact.
例如,像 “Es fundamental que los gobiernos inviertan más en energías limpias”(各国政府必须加大对清洁能源的投资)这样的句子,揭示了一个强烈的观点和行动呼吁。你应该将其识别为建议而非事实。
5. Identifying Author’s Purpose and Tone | 辨别作者意图与语气
A common question in the case study asks you to determine the author’s purpose – whether it is to inform, persuade, entertain, or criticise. The tone can be formal, sarcastic, optimistic, or alarmist. Adjectives used and the level of modality (e.g., ‘podría’, ‘debería’, ‘tiene que’) provide direct clues.
案例分析中常见的一个问题是判断作者的意图——是告知、劝说、娱乐还是批判。语气可能是正式的、讽刺的、乐观的或危言耸听的。作者使用的形容词和情态级别(如 “podría”、”debería”、”tiene que”)提供了直接线索。
If the text uses statistics and expert quotes predominantly, it is likely informative. Emotive language and rhetorical questions suggest persuasion. Compare these two extracts:
如果文本主要使用统计数据和专家引言,则可能是告知性的。情感化的语言和反问句表明是劝说性的。对比以下两个摘录:
Extract A (informative): ‘Según un estudio reciente, la tasa de reciclaje ha aumentado un 15% en los últimos dos años.’
摘录A(告知性):“据最近一项研究显示,回收利用率在过去两年中提高了15%。”
Extract B (persuasive): ‘¿No crees que es hora de que todos actuemos para salvar nuestro planeta? Cada pequeño gesto cuenta.’
摘录B(劝说性):“难道你不认为是时候每个人都为拯救地球行动起来了吗?每一个小小的举动都很重要。”
When the question asks ‘¿Cuál es la intención del autor?’, support your judgement with a brief phrase from the text.

6. Structuring Your Response | 构建答案结构
A well-organised answer mirrors the mark scheme’s expectations. For Spanish-language responses, use a clear paragraph structure: opening statement, evidence from the text, and a concluding remark or personal reaction if required. For English responses, follow the same logic but pay close attention to the precise wording demanded by the task.
结构清晰的答案反映了评分标准的期望。对于西班牙语回答,使用清晰的段落结构:开头陈述、文本证据,以及必要时给出的结论或个人反应。对于英语回答,遵循同样的逻辑,但要密切注意题目要求的精确用词。
Always link back to the question. If the question asks for ‘two reasons why young people prefer digital communication’, do not list four reasons. Concision and relevance are rewarded.
始终扣题。如果问题要求给出”年轻人偏爱数字沟通的两个原因”,不要列出四个原因。简洁和切题会得到加分。
When a summary is required in Spanish, begin by paraphrasing, not by lifting whole sentences. For example:
当需要用西班牙语进行总结时,先从转述开始,不要整句照搬。例如:
-
Original: ‘Los jóvenes pasan una media de cuatro horas al día frente a las pantallas.’
原文:”年轻人平均每天在屏幕前四小时。”
-
Summary: ‘El texto señala que los jóvenes dedican mucho tiempo diario a los dispositivos electrónicos.’
总结:”文本指出年轻人每天在电子设备上花费大量时间。”
7. Sample Case Study: Environmental Awareness | 案例分析示例:环保意识
Text (abridged):
文本(节选):
‘La creciente preocupación por el cambio climático ha llevado a muchos jóvenes a participar en movimientos ecologistas. Sin embargo, algunos expertos advierten que el activismo digital no siempre se traduce en cambios reales. Según una encuesta, el 70% de los adolescentes comparte contenido ecológico en redes sociales, pero solo el 30% adopta hábitos sostenibles como reducir el uso de plásticos o ahorrar agua. Es necesario que las escuelas fomenten una educación ambiental más práctica y menos teórica.’
“对气候变化日益增长的担忧促使许多年轻人参与环保运动。然而,一些专家警告说,数字行动主义并不总能转化为实际的改变。根据一项调查,70%的青少年在社交网络上分享环保内容,但只有30%的人采取可持续的习惯,例如减少塑料使用或节约用水。学校有必要推动一种更实践、更少理论化的环境教育。”
Question 1 (Spanish): Resume en dos frases la idea principal del texto.
问题1(西班牙语):用两句话概括文本的中心思想。
Model answer: El texto explica que los jóvenes muestran interés por el medio ambiente sobre todo en redes sociales. No obstante, destaca que este interés no siempre se refleja en comportamientos ecológicos cotidianos.
参考答案:文本解释说年轻人主要在社交网络上表现出对环境的兴趣。然而,它强调这种兴趣并不总反映在日常的环保行为中。
Question 2 (English): What does the author recommend and why?
问题2(英语):作者建议了什么?为什么提出这个建议?
Model answer: The author recommends that schools provide more practical environmental education because current digital activism does not lead to meaningful changes in teenagers’ daily habits, as shown by the low percentage of those who adopt sustainable practices.
参考答案:作者建议学校提供更实践的环境教育,因为目前的数字行动主义并未给青少年日常习惯带来实质改变,这一点从采取可持续实践的比例较低可以看出。
8. Sample Case Study: Youth and Technology | 案例分析示例:青年与科技
Text (abridged):
文本(节选):
‘La adicción al teléfono móvil se ha convertido en un problema de salud pública entre los adolescentes. Muchos jóvenes admiten que no pueden pasar más de una hora sin consultar sus notificaciones. Por otro lado, las aplicaciones de mensajería han cambiado la forma de relacionarse, haciendo que las conversaciones cara a cara sean menos frecuentes. Los psicólogos recomiendan establecer límites diarios y fomentar actividades al aire libre. A pesar de los riesgos, la tecnología también ofrece oportunidades educativas innegables.’
“手机成瘾已成为青少年中的公共卫生问题。许多年轻人承认,他们无法超过一小时不查看通知。另一方面,通讯应用程序改变了交往方式,使面对面交流变得不太频繁。心理学家建议设定每日限制并推动户外活动。尽管存在风险,技术也提供了不可否认的教育机会。”
Question 1 (English): Identify two concerns raised about mobile phone use and two positive aspects mentioned.
问题1(英语):指出文中提到的关于使用手机的两个担忧和两个积极方面。
Model answer: Concerns: 1) addiction that prevents teenagers from being offline for more than an hour; 2) reduced face-to-face interaction. Positive aspects: 1) educational opportunities; 2) although not expanded in the extract, the text recognises technological benefits.
参考答案:担忧:1)成瘾使青少年无法离线超过一小时;2)面对面互动减少。积极方面:1)教育机会;2)虽然摘录中没有展开,但文本承认技术的好处。
Question 2 (Spanish): Según el texto, ¿qué soluciones proponen los expertos?
问题2(西班牙语):根据文本,专家提出了哪些解决方案?
Model answer: Los psicólogos proponen que los jóvenes pongan límites diarios al uso del móvil y que participen en más actividades al aire libre.
参考答案:心理学家建议年轻人设定每日使用手机的限制,并参与更多的户外活动。
9. Common Mistakes to Avoid | 常见误区
One frequent error is lifting phrases directly from the source without demonstrating comprehension. Paraphrasing is essential to show you have processed the information. Copying large chunks will not gain marks, even if the content is accurate.
一个常见错误是直接从原文抄录短语而不显示理解。转述是证明你已处理信息的关键。照搬大段文字即使内容正确,也不会得分。
Another pitfall is answering in the wrong language. Always check the rubric: if the response is required in Spanish, writing in English will invalidate that part. Conversely, offering detailed English analysis for a Spanish summary wastes time and misses the target.
另一陷阱是用错误的语言作答。始终检查题目要求:如果回答需要用西班牙语,用英语书写则该部分无效。反之,在西班牙语总结任务中提供详尽的英语分析,既浪费时间又偏离目标。
Grammatical carelessness with accents, verb endings, and gender agreement can obscure meaning. Even if your idea is correct, inaccuracies lower the linguistic quality mark. Proofread for common slips: ‘la problema’ (wrong gender), ‘ellos está’ (verb form), missing ‘n’ in ‘también’, etc.
重音、动词词尾和性数一致上的语法疏忽,可能会模糊意义。即使观点正确,不准确之处会降低语言质量评分。复读检查常见小错:”la problema”(性错)、”ellos está”(动词形式错误)、”también”中漏掉”n”等。
-
Use the planning time to jot down key vocabulary and phrases you might need.
利用规划时间记下可能用到关键词汇和短语。
-
Avoid vague statements like ‘es bueno’ or ‘es malo’ without justification.
避免使用 “es bueno” 或 “es malo” 这样没有理由的模糊陈述。
10. Practice Exercises with Model Answers | 附带范文的练习题
Exercise Text:
练习文本:
‘El teletrabajo ha transformado el mercado laboral. Por un lado, ofrece flexibilidad y reduce los desplazamientos; por otro, puede provocar aislamiento social y dificultades para desconectar. Una encuesta reciente indica que el 60% de los trabajadores jóvenes prefiere un modelo híbrido. Los sindicatos reclaman una regulación que proteja el derecho a la desconexión digital.’
“远程办公已经改变了劳动力市场。一方面,它提供了灵活性并减少了通勤;另一方面,它可能导致社会孤立和难以脱离工作。近期一项调查显示,60%的年轻员工更喜欢混合模式。工会呼吁制定法规保护数字断开权。”
Task 1 (English): Summarise the advantages and disadvantages of teleworking according to the text.
任务1(英语):根据文本概括远程办公的优点和缺点。
Model answer: Advantages include flexibility and fewer commutes. Disadvantages are potential social isolation and difficulty disconnecting from work. The hybrid model is preferred by 60% of young workers.
参考答案:优点包括灵活性和更少的通勤。缺点是潜在的社会孤立以及难以脱离工作。60%的年轻员工偏爱混合模式。
Task 2 (Spanish): ¿Qué piden los sindicatos y por qué crees que es importante?
任务2(西班牙语):工会要求什么,你为什么认为这很重要?
Model answer: Los sindicatos piden una regulación que garantice el derecho a la desconexión digital. En mi opinión, es importante porque permite a los trabajadores separar su vida laboral de la personal y prevenir el estrés.
参考答案:工会要求一项保障数字断开权的法规。我认为这很重要,因为它能让员工区分工作与个人生活,并预防压力。
11. Final Tips for Exam Day | 考试当日终极建议
On the day of the exam, manage your time wisely. Decide how many minutes you will spend reading, answering each question, and proofreading. Many candidates lose marks by spending too long on one part and rushing the rest.
考试当天,明智地管理时间。确定阅读、回答每个问题和检查分别用多少分钟。许多考生因在某一部分耗时过久而仓促完成剩余部分,导致失分。
Stay calm when encountering unfamiliar vocabulary. Use the context and your knowledge of word roots, prefixes, and suffixes to make an educated guess. Often, the surrounding sentences provide enough clues to infer meaning.
遇到生词时保持冷静。利用上下文以及你对词根、前缀和后缀的知识进行合理推测。通常,前后句子能提供足够线索来推断含义。
Finally, remember that the case study rewards engaged, thoughtful reading. Practice regularly with past papers, timed exercises, and peer feedback. The more you expose yourself to Spanish texts on current affairs, the more natural the analysis will become.
最后,记住案例分析奖励投入且富有思考的阅读。定期用历年真题、限时练习和同伴反馈进行训练。你对西班牙语时事文本的接触越多,分析过程就会变得越自然。
